Please Log inWe’re bringing together Haldi and Mehendi into one celebration. Haldi is a pre-wedding ritual where close family and friends apply turmeric as a blessing for protection and good fortune. Mehendi follows, with intricate henna designs on hands and feet, music in the background, and everyone settling into the weekend.
Rooted in Indian tradition and shaped by our life together, this event is where two families, two histories, and two cultures meet in one place.
Rooted in Indian tradition, the Sangeet is an evening of music, dance, and celebration where families and friends come together before the wedding day. For us it is especially meaningful as we bring together two cultures, two families, and the people we love most for a night of performances, cocktails, dinner, and dancing in Lake Como.
We invite you to join us for our wedding day in Lake Como, where we will honor both of our heritages through a fusion of traditions at a historic lakeside villa.
Hindu Ceremony
The day begins with the Baraat procession, as the groom arrives surrounded by music, dancing, and celebration, leading into our traditional Hindu ceremony beneath a lakeside mandap. There, we will take part in sacred rituals and blessings alongside our families.
Christian Ceremony
After time to relax and enjoy the villa and its lake views, we will gather again at sunset for our Christian ceremony, an exchange of vows in an elegant outdoor setting overlooking the water.
Reception
The evening continues with cocktails on the terrace, followed by a seated dinner, toasts, and dancing as we celebrate bringing together two traditions, and becoming one family.

DRESS CODE
To reflect the two ceremonies, guests are invited to dress accordingly (Outfit changes for morning and evening):
Morning: Baraat & Hindu Ceremony
Traditional Indian attire in vibrant hues is encouraged.
Ladies may opt for lehengas, sarees, anarkalis, or shararas with statement jewelry.
Gentlemen may wear sherwanis, kurtas with churidar, or bandhgala suits.
Evening: Christian Ceremony & Reception Black-tie formal. Ladies may choose floor-length gowns, or refined cocktail dresses. Gentlemen are invited to wear tuxedos with bowties.
Wedding Colors: We kindly ask guests to avoid whites and creams for the Christian Ceremony, which is reserved for the couple. Feel free to wear any color of your choice for the Hindu Ceremony.
Comfortable footwear is recommended, as the celebration will move through the villa’s gardens and indoors.
